My work moves between the digital and the tactile: there’s a time for technology, and a time to get messy, covered in paint, and connected to the physical world.

I grew up without TV in Santa Cruz, CA, so most of my childhood was spent raising tadpoles, experimenting in the kitchen, and making art. I wanted to be a professional ballerina, so I trained like crazy, traveled a ton, and ended up hanging out in many chiropractor and doctors' offices. I loved the infographics on the walls, but it wasn't until my senior year of college that I realized you could do that as a job.

After switching from ballet to biology, I moved to Panama and worked in conservation ecology with the Smithsonian. Though I loved being immersed in the scientific world, I saw the importance of being a liaison between the scientific community and general public.

With that in mind, I moved to Providence to get a certificate in Natural Science Illustration, then Boston to work as a Curriculum Illustrator for Tufts School of Medicine's Center for Science Education. Wanting to expand my technical skillset, I did a masters in Medical Visualization and Human Anatomy with a focus on interactive application design. Following that program, I ran the animation department for a surgical video journal. Since then I've freelanced across industries, with illustrations selected for awards at the World Congress of Surgery, and web designs facilitating remote teaching.
